Seriously Supporting Breast Cancer ResearchChocolate Mill was proud to support RMIT marketing students Samantha Jordan, Abbey Glassford, Ella Cooper, Grace Stripekis, Georgina De Visser and Danielle Pantaloni raise funds for Breast Cancer Research on Saturday 6th October, 2007. The students raised over $700 from selling cupcakes and sweet buns in the Hot Chocolate Cafe, as well as giving people the opportunity to sponsor a "Pink Lady". Chocolate Mill's support included a $100 donation. Well done girls! | ||||

Celebrating the opening of our Hot Chocolate Cafe.
Over 60 attended an event on Thursday evening, the 23rd March 2006, when the big 5kg block was broken to officially open the new cafe. Plenty of food and beverages together with good company and warm weather made for a terrific night. Chris thanked those that were involved in helping to make the extension and support it happening.

Chocolate Mill is celebrating 2 years openYes, we are celebrating 2 years on the 21st November, 2005. It's hard to fathom the amount of hard work that has created an ever increasing success story in chocolate. Not only are we busy in our business but we are also expanding next door. This expansion includes a "Hot Chocolate Cafe" which we hope will be open by mid December. Chris is building the the extension during the week and then in the kitchen on weekends. Visit from the Lions Club and CWA "Great Crib Trek" We were very excited to receive a visit from the brave team doing the "Great Crib Trek". They are pushing an humidicrib (90kg) over 400km from Albury to Melbourne to gather funds to provide affordable accommodation for families from rural and interstate regions who have loved ones receiving treatment at the Mercy Hospital for Women and Austin Health in Melbourne. The Great Trek Team at the Chocolate Mill included Diana Morgan, Heather Speer, Wendy Cauchy, Rachael O'Connor, Gary Ward, Gary Bromley, Cathy Godbold, Judith Bell, Ron Bell, Hendy O'Toole and Gerrard O'Toole. Chocolate Mill supplied chocolate for the participants to combat the merciless hills around Hepburn and Daylesford. We wish you all the best and encourage people to assist however they can for the funding of Lions House. Check out their website to find out more. |

On Friday May 21st, we celebrated 6 months since we opened our doors. We have taken on more staff and now have 2 new machines from Holland which will help us to keep up with the ever increasing demand for our chocolates. We have further plans for expansion and will keep you informed on more detail of this in the coming months. |

5 Months on... Well, things have been incredibly busy here, with no time to update the News diary. And so much has happened I don't know where to start. We have been lucky enough to have articles and editorials in the Advocate News and Lost Magazine (Daylesford Region), The Courier (Ballarat), The Age and the Herald Sun. We've also had a visit from the "Great Outdoors" crew, so we're looking forward for the segment to be shown. Easter has come and gone like a whirlwind and I think we are still recovering from the 'holidays'. Chris and I worked on entries in the 2004 Melbourne Food and Wine Easter Egg Competition. We have them on display in the shop until the end of April. | ||||
